Abstract
This circuit provides a digital output indicating the presence or absence of the infrared (IR) carrier signal. The incoming IR signal is sampled by a clock at a frequency which is about 4 times the carrier frequency. The high and low samples are tabulated in two counters in a race. When 8 high or 16 low samples are counted, the envelope status flip flop is set or reset, respectively, and both counters are reset. The output of the envelope status flip flop represents the envelope of the IR carrier signal.
